Ueno Park
Ueno Park is one of Japan’s public park, located in Taito, Tokyo, Japan. The park opened in 1873 as declared by the Cabinet decree along with the other parks: Shiba, Asakusa, Fukugawa and Asukayama Park. Ueno park is famous to tourists visiting Japan. Why? Ueno park is home to over 1000 Sakura trees, during spring